Adequate lease horizon. Around 73 years of remaining lease keeps CPF eligibility intact and supports standard 30-year loan tenor for most buyer profiles. Within a 5-10 year hold, lease-decay effects are negligible; beyond that, monitor the year-60 threshold for CPF usage caps.

Genuine walk-to-MRT access. Tai Seng sits about 0.48km away — true walking distance, not the elastic 800m claim that some listings stretch. For tenants and commuter-owners, this anchors rental demand and supports a steady capital-value floor across cycles.

Boutique character. With 21 units, THE ARECA keeps a low-density character — fewer residents per facility, quieter corridors, more curated common spaces. Suits buyers prioritising unit-interior quality and neighbour proximity over deep facilities breadth.

School-belt proximity. Red Swastika School sits about 0.54km away, with additional schools clustered nearby. Family households on 24-month tenancies anchor the rental pool, which materially improves vacancy economics for landlord-owners.

Lease tenor below 75 years. With roughly 73 years remaining, CPF usage starts to be capped (the 95-year rule reduces utilisation as lease decays), and bank loan tenor compresses correspondingly. The resale buyer pool narrows toward older buyers with shorter horizons.

Thin transaction history. With only 10 recorded sales, comparable-sales analysis is fragile — a single outlier transaction can skew the apparent price level by 5-10%. Triangulate with nearby district comparables rather than rely on within-project averages alone.

District supply pipeline. Non-prime districts are more sensitive to GLS pipeline additions; check the URA Master Plan 2019 confirmed and provisional land sales schedule for the immediate 5-year window. New launches at 10-20% lower PSF can compress secondary-market resale velocity for 18-24 months around their launch dates.

New Sale vs Resale Mix

Of the 2,426 condo transactions recorded in District 19 over the last 12 months, 93% resale, 5% new sale, 2% sub sale. A resale-heavy mix points to an established market trading on fundamentals; a new-sale-heavy mix means developer launches are setting the price benchmarks.

Price Index Check

The ShiokNest Price Index for District 19 reads 137.0 as of June 2026 — up 2.0% year-on-year. The index tracks repeat-sales price movement, so it is less distorted by shifts in what happens to be transacting than a raw average PSF.
